Tool materials:
System version: Windows 10
Brand model: Any computer or mobile phone
Software version : The latest version of WinToUSB
1. Choose a suitable U disk
1. First, we need to choose a suitable U disk as the boot disk. It is recommended to choose a USB flash drive with a capacity greater than 8GB to ensure that it can accommodate the operating system image file.
2. At the same time, make sure that the U disk has a fast read and write speed, which can improve the efficiency of making and using the boot disk.
2. Download and install WinToUSB
1. Open the browser, search for and download the latest version of WinToUSB software.
2. Install the WinToUSB software and follow the prompts to complete the installation process.
3. Make a USB bootable disk
1. Open the WinToUSB software and select the "Create a bootable USB disk" option.
2. Insert the U disk into the computer and select the U disk as the target disk.
3. Select the operating system image file, which can be an ISO file or a CD.
4. Click the "Start Production" button and wait for the production process to be completed.
4. Use the USB boot disk
1. Insert the prepared USB boot disk into the computer or mobile phone where the operating system needs to be installed.
2. Restart your computer or mobile phone and follow the prompts to enter the BIOS settings.
3. In the BIOS settings, set the USB boot disk as the first boot item.
4. Save the settings and restart the computer or mobile phone. The system will boot from the USB boot disk.
